WebIf you’re paid biweekly (every other week), you’ll receive 26 paychecks each year. Now take the target amount you set for your saving goal and divide it by 26. You will need to save $57.69 a week or $115.38 biweekly to have $3,000 by the end of a year. See the deposit charts below for the saving schedule. The final deposits will be slightly different to total $3,000 exactly.
